Key Responsibilities

  • •Define and continuously evolve Reddit’s worldwide IP litigation strategy aligned to product roadmaps and business goals
  • •Oversee the global IP portfolio to ensure alignment with business priorities and differentiation objectives
  • •Shape and refine international litigation and strategic stance on emerging IP matters
  • •Advise cross-functional partners and Legal team members on copyright, trademark, patent, and trade secret matters
  • •Collaborate with engineering, product, and legal teams (and outside counsel) to mitigate IP risk and build Reddit’s patent portfolio

Key Requirements

  • •JD (top academic background) and a current license in a state bar in the United States
  • •10+ years of experience as an IP litigator, preferably with a mix of big law firm training and in-house experience at a tech/fast-paced company
  • •Strong understanding of copyright, patent, trademark, and trade secret law
  • •Ability to lead a wide variety of IP matters and proactively collaborate across teams
  • •Proven track record navigating intricate/emerging copyright litigation challenges

Company Brief

Reddit
Operates Reddit, a large online community and discussion platform where users submit content, comment, and vote across topic-based communities (subreddits); monetizes via advertising, premium subscriptions, and awards.
